Royals' Mason Black: Viewed as reliever

Black allowed no hits and two walks over a scoreless inning in Thursday's Cactus League loss to the Rangers. He did not record a strikeout.

The right-hander has worked primarily as a starter in the minors, but Royals manager Matt Quatraro said Thursday that the organization views him as more of a versatile relief arm, per Perla Peredes of MLB.com. After being traded from the Giants in November, a retooling of his repertoire has proven effective thus far in Cactus League play, as Black has tossed five scoreless innings across four appearances. The 26-year-old may open the season with Triple-A Omaha, but he could contribute at the big-league level in 2026.
